A THEATER OF COERCION
Coercion is "compulsion of a free agent"; I practice this as a way of making art. The Theater of Coercion is a space whereby participants, without their knowledge or consent, are co-opted and become involved in the act of generating art.
II suffer from a nagging urge to make connections with and between other human beings. I am continually trolling my environment for ways to compel "free agents" to enter into my "theater," thereby connecting them to me. Art is the result.
This exploration into art as a social science and social experiment foregrounds the usually humdrum nature of an individual's experience, and, against this backdrop, forges a connection that is new, strange, and unsettling. This contact with another creates a dialogue and opens into a collective. I am consistent in my attempt to shed societies isolated loneliness. By making with others, we no longer walk nor act as strangers.
